Understanding GamStop and Non-GamStop Casinos
GamStop is the UK's national self-exclusion scheme designed to help individuals who wish to restrict their access to online gambling services. When a player registers with GamStop, they are excluded from all licensed UK gambling operators for a predetermined period, typically ranging from six months to five years. Legal Status and Regulatory Framework
It's essential to recognize that while casinos not on GamStop operate legally within their respective jurisdictions, the UK Gambling Commission does not regulate them. These platforms are typically licensed by other respected gaming authorities such as the Malta Gaming Authority, Curaçao eGaming License, or the Isle of Man Gambling Supervision Commission.
Players should understand that accessing these casinos is not illegal in the United Kingdom, but regulatory protections differ significantly from GamStop-listed operators. Non-GamStop casinos must still maintain professional standards and fair gaming practices, but they operate under different compliance frameworks and dispute resolution procedures.

Important Warnings and Considerations
While legitimate non-GamStop casinos exist, the sector also attracts unlicensed and potentially fraudulent operators. Players must conduct thorough due diligence, verifying licensing information and checking independent reviews before depositing money. Reputable platforms transparently display their licensing details and regulatory information.
Players should be aware that accessing non-GamStop casinos may result in limited access to UK consumer protections and dispute resolution services. Chargeback protections through UK banking may be limited, and the Financial Ombudsman Service typically cannot assist with non-GamStop operators.
